Mandatory wearing of masks in public places introduced in Iran
Temporary mandatory wearing of masks in closed spaces and in public places is introduced in Iran. This was announced on June 28 by President Hassan Rouhani on IRINN. Wearing protective medical masks is mandatory anywhere where crowding is supposed. In the period from July 5 to July 21, wearing masks will become mandatory. If necessary, this period will be extended. In addition, Rouhani did not rule out the possibility of tightening restrictions in areas of the country with an unfavorable epidemiological situation. Restrictions can be introduced at the initiative of local headquarters to combat coronavirus. The statement of the President of Iran is associated with an increase in the daily number of detected infections with coronavirus per day and with an increase in fatalities among patients with coronavirus. Earlier, the news agency reported 2,465 cases of coronavirus infection confirmed in Iran per day. In total, more than 220 thousand cases of SARS-CoV-2 infection have been detected in the country since the beginning of the pandemic, more than 10 thousand cases of fatality have been recorded.
